2012-03-22 36 views
1

我有以下問題。 Spring爲我們提供了一個使用JSON作爲返回對象來構建AJAX的絕佳機會。但是如果我想在代碼中手動轉換某個對象呢?我可以直接調用一些Springs方法並進行融合,而不是通過手動或使用其他庫來進行融合?Spring 3和JSON可能手動轉換?

回答

3

是的,你可以。

在上下文中只要定義MappingJacksonHttpMessageConverter豆:

<bean id="MappingJacksonHttpMessageConverter" class="org.springframework.http.converter.json.MappingJacksonHttpMessageConverter"> 

而且你可以使用它的方法來轉換。 更多,你可以定義自己的Jakson objectMapper它:

​​

,並使用此objectMapper定製convertations。